Winter Vegetable Soup

Description

Warm up with this delightful Winter Vegetable Soup, featuring a medley of fresh vegetables, beans, and flavorful herbs. It’s a simple yet hearty dish that makes a perfect quick dinner or healthy meal for the whole family.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 onion chopped
  • 3 carrots chopped
  • 2 sticks celery chopped
  • 1 parsnip peeled and chopped
  • 1 small sweet potato peeled and chopped
  • 2 large potatoes ch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 1/2 tbsp dried thyme or 1 tbsp fresh thyme
  • 400 g cannellini beans canned
  • 400 g canned tomatoes
  • 600 ml vegetable stock or chicken stock
  • 250 g green cabbage chopped
  • 150 g fresh spinach
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  • Heat olive oil in a large saucepan over medium heat.
  • Add chopped onion, carrots, celery, parsnip, and both types of potatoes, cooking for 10-15 minutes while stirring frequently.
  • Stir in minced garlic and thyme, cooking for an additional 2 minutes.
  • Drain and rinse the cannellini beans. Add them to the pot along with the tomatoes and stock.
  • Bring the mixture to a boil, then simmer for 20 minutes.
  • Incorporate chopped cabbage and spinach, seasoning to taste with salt and pepper. Cook for another 5 minutes.
  • Serve with a spoonful of pistou, a sprinkle of freshly grated parmesan cheese, and crusty bread on the side.

Notes

Feel free to use any seasonal vegetables you have on hand.
For added flavor, consider adding herbs like rosemary or bay leaf during cooking.
This soup can be made ahead and st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
